Carmelo Anthony announces retirement after 19 seasons in the National Basketball Association.

Anthony played collegiate basketball at Syracuse University, where he led his team to win the National Championship in 2003. In the same year, he was drafted third overall by the Denver Nuggets and spent the first eight seasons of his career there, establishing himself as one of the top scorers in the league. He led the Nuggets to the playoffs every year from 2004 to 2010 and helped them reach the Western Conference Finals in 2009.

He was traded to the Knicks in 2011, where he became the face of the franchise and led them to their first playoff appearance in more than a decade. He was a six-time All-Star during his time in New York and led the NBA in scoring during the 2012-13 season.

Anthony spent one season with the Thunder, where he played a supporting role alongside Russell Westbrook and Paul George. While he struggled with his shooting efficiency, he still provided a scoring punch off the bench for a team that reached the playoffs.

He also played with the Houston Rockets from 2018-2019, but tenure with the Rockets was short-lived, as he played in only 10 games before being waived. He struggled to adjust to a reduced role and clashed with the coaching staff over his playing time.

Anthony joined the Trail Blazers in the middle of the 2019-20 season and provided a scoring boost off the bench. He became a starter for the team in the 2020-21 season and helped them reach the playoffs.

Finally ending his career in a Lakers jersey.

He is a 10-time NBA All-Star, and he has won several awards and accolades throughout his career.

Overall, Anthony is known for his scoring ability and his ability to create his own shot. He has been a valuable contributor to every team he has played for, although his impact has varied depending on the specific team and situation.

Social Cause

Carmelo Anthony’s social cause is focused on creating positive change in his community and promoting social justice through various initiatives. 

Some of the causes he supports include:

The Carmelo Anthony Foundation

Anthony established his own non-profit organization, which focuses on empowering and enriching the lives of underserved youth and their families through education, recreation, and community outreach programs.

Criminal justice reform

Anthony is a strong advocate for criminal justice reform, working to promote policies that address issues like mass incarceration and racial profiling. He has also been a vocal supporter of the Black Lives Matter movement.

Hunger relief

Anthony has been a supporter of hunger relief programs and initiatives, partnering with organizations like Feed the Children and the Food Bank for New York City. He has also worked to raise awareness about food insecurity through his social media platforms.

Community development

Anthony has also been involved in various community development initiatives, particularly in his hometown of Baltimore, where he launched a program focused on revitalizing local neighborhoods by providing affordable housing and job training opportunities.

Anthony’s social cause centers around creating opportunities, promoting equality, and lifting up those who face systemic barriers in society.
